Today, the S&P/ASX 200 Index (ASX: XJO) posted a slight move to the downside. At the end of the session, the benchmark index fell 0.08% to 7,447.1 points.

It was a mixed session on the ASX today, with the market split in two directions. Unfortunately, the gains from mining and energy shares weren't enough to compensate for the undesirable segments of the share market. The most disappointing performances were witnessed across the consumer discretionary, healthcare, tech sectors today.

However, the question is: which shares delivered the biggest returns to investors on the ASX today? Here are the top ten stocks that came through for investors:

Top 10 ASX shares countdown today

Looking at the top 200 listed companies, Novonix Ltd (ASX: NVX) was the biggest gainer today. Shares in the battery technology company jumped 10.91% after announcing its plans to list on the Nasdaq exchange in the United States. Find out more about Novonix here.

The next biggest gaining ASX share today was AGL Energy Ltd (ASX: AGL). The energy giant experienced a positive session to the tune of 8.60% today following an upgrade on the company's shares from analysts at Credit Suisse. Uncover the latest AGL Energy details here.
